Biography

Camila Cabello is a Cuban-American singer and songwriter who first gained fame as a member of the girl group Fifth Harmony. Born on March 3, 1997, in Havana, Cuba, she later relocated to Miami, Florida. Cabello embarked on a solo career after leaving the group in 2016, releasing hits like 'Havana' and 'Señorita'. She has won several awards for her music and is known for her soulful voice and Latin-inspired pop sound.
